The President must be a senior with a minimum of one year of membership. The President will:

  1. oversee, direct, organize, and represent the chapter;
  2. call meetings;
  3. direct the induction ceremony;
  4. meet with the sponsor weekly.

The Vice-President must be a senior with a minimum of one year of membership. The Vice-President will:

  1. act in the President’s absence;
  2. perform specific duties delegated by the president;
  3. administer the election of officers in the spring.

The SmartIT Secretary must have at least one year prior membership. The Secretary will:

  1. take minutes;
  2. conduct correspondence, such as induction invitations and thank you notes;
  3. help maintain attendance records.

The Treasurer must have at least one year prior membership. The Treasurer will:

  1. collect, record and turn monies into the sponsor for deposit;
  2. help maintain attendance records;

The Reporter must have at least one year prior membership. The Reporter will:

  1. write articles for the school and local newspapers to inform the school and community of chapter activities;
  2. publicize service projects.

Any officer who does not perform his duties will be removed from that office, and an acting officer will be named.
